## Processor Power

One of the key components of AI hardware in smart home devices is the processor. These processors are specially designed to handle complex AI algorithms and machine learning tasks, allowing devices to process data quickly and efficiently. For example, in a smart security camera, the processor analyzes video footage in real-time, looking for any unusual activity or identifying familiar faces. This processing power enables the camera to send instant notifications to the homeowner’s smartphone, alerting them to potential threats or suspicious activity.

## Sensors and Data Collection

In addition to powerful processors, smart home devices are equipped with a variety of sensors that collect data about the environment and user behavior. These sensors can detect changes in temperature, humidity, light levels, and movement, providing valuable insights that help devices adapt to their surroundings and anticipate user needs. For example, a smart thermostat uses sensors to monitor room temperature and occupancy, adjusting the settings to maintain a comfortable and energy-efficient environment.

## Machine Learning Algorithms

AI hardware in smart home devices also includes sophisticated machine learning algorithms that enable devices to learn from user interactions and improve their performance over time. These algorithms analyze data collected by sensors and processors, identifying patterns, preferences, and anomalies that help devices make informed decisions. For example, a smart lighting system can learn the homeowner’s daily routine and automatically adjust the lighting levels in each room accordingly.

## Voice Recognition Technology

Voice recognition technology is another crucial component of AI hardware in smart home devices. This technology allows users to interact with their devices using natural language commands, making it easier and more convenient to control smart home functions. Voice-activated assistants like Amazon’s Alexa and Google Assistant use advanced speech recognition algorithms to understand and respond to user queries, whether it’s adjusting the thermostat, playing music, or ordering groceries.

### Smart Thermostats

Smart thermostats like the Nest Learning Thermostat use AI algorithms to analyze user behavior, temperature patterns, and weather conditions to create a personalized heating and cooling schedule. By learning user preferences and adjusting settings accordingly, these devices help homeowners save energy and create a comfortable living environment.

### Smart Security Cameras

Smart security cameras like the Ring Video Doorbell Pro use AI-powered motion detection algorithms to identify potential threats and send instant notifications to homeowners’ smartphones. These devices provide real-time security monitoring and peace of mind, allowing homeowners to keep an eye on their property even when they’re away.

### Voice-Activated Assistants

Voice-activated assistants like Amazon’s Alexa and Google Assistant use advanced natural language processing algorithms to understand and respond to user commands. These assistants can control smart home devices, provide information, set reminders, and even engage in casual conversations with users, creating a seamless and interactive user experience.
